Comorbid Conditions

Maybe it's all One Disease?

Chronic prostatitis/chronic pelvic pain syndrome (CP/CPPS) patients frequently complain of a typical set of other conditions that seem to be separate diseases but are probably part of one symptom complex. Research into Interstitial Cystitis, which many people think is merely a form of CPPS, has proved that the condition is not isolated to the lower genitourinary tract, but more of a whole-body condition.

Additionally, it must always be kept in mind that people with Reiter's Disease and the similar condition called Ankylosing Spondylitis do sometimes report chronic abacterial prostatitis. However the vast majority of CP/CPPS patients do not have bone disease on radiograph examination.
